The world is under immense pressure to reduce its carbon footprint and make strides toward a more sustainable future. While there is no one-size-fits-all solution to this challenge, electric vehicles (EVs) are becoming increasingly popular as an eco-friendly option for those looking to reduce their environmental impact.
FREMONT, CA: Due to their minimal emissions and ability to lessen the effects of climate change, EVs are becoming more prevalent. They come in a variety of shapes and sizes, including electric motorbikes, bicycles, and scooters. Increasing affordability encourages more producers to enter the market with their distinctive products.
Each year, new models of electric vehicles are released, and the technology behind them is rapidly improving. Electric cars are now capable of travelling longer distances than ever before, with some models being able to travel up to 300 miles on a single charge. Being more efficient, many models are now capable of adopting regenerative braking systems to capture energy while driving and convert it back into power. Consequently, electric vehicles are highly efficient since they can produce their power once they are on the road. In recent years, manufacturers have improved their efficiency and are now offering regenerative braking on many models.
Electric cars have numerous benefits for both the environment and the driver.
• Low Emissions: Electric automobiles are substantially better for the environment than gasoline-powered cars since they emit significantly less pollution. EVs are far less likely to cause climate change and can cut air pollution from tailpipe emissions.
• Low Maintenance Costs: With fewer moving parts and no oil changes or engine maintenance, EVs require far less maintenance than gasoline-powered vehicles, which reduces their ownership and operating costs.
• Quieter: significantly quieter than cars driven by petrol, reducing noise pollution. They are therefore a preferable alternative for anyone seeking to lower environmental noise levels who live in crowded urban areas.
• Energy-efficient: Compared to gasoline-powered vehicles, they use less energy and produce less waste, making them more efficient. The fact that they lessen pollution is one of the key advantages of electric vehicles. Nitrogen oxide, carbon monoxide, and particulate matter are just a few of the toxic emissions that gasoline-powered vehicles emit in enormous numbers. These contaminants may negatively affect air quality and pose a risk to one's health. In contrast, electric vehicles emit far less pollution than gasoline-powered cars. As they don't contribute to air pollution, there will likely be cleaner air, greater health, and a higher standard of living as a result. In addition to reducing smog and ground-level ozone, they also lower the levels of pollutants in cities. This can lead to greater overall health, decreased breathing issues, and enhanced visibility.
Unlike gasoline-powered vehicles, these vehicles use electricity instead of gasoline for charging. This is significant because burning fossil fuels causes the atmosphere to become more carbon dioxide-rich, which causes climate change. Using EVs can contribute to lessening our reliance on fossil fuels and moving us closer to a sustainable future. This may aid in lowering atmospheric carbon dioxide levels and reducing the rate of climate change.
